Apathy after hip fracture: a potential target for intervention to improve functional outcomes

The authors examined apathy symptoms, their improvement, and their association with functional recovery, after a hip fracture. Of 126 subjects, 37% had clinically significant apathy symptoms, which predicted functional outcome (i.e., poorer recovery from the fracture among those with higher baseline...
